Abstract

In the title molecular salt, C26H24N3S+center dot Br-, the dihedral angles between the thiazole ring and its attached phenyl and benzoyl rings are 54.81 (7) and 85.51 (7)degrees, respectively. In the crystal, ion pairs are linked by C -H center dot center dot center dot Br and N -H center dot center dot center dot Br hydrogen bonds and are connected into helical chains extending along the c-axis direction by weak, electrostatic S center dot center dot center dot Br- interactions. A Hirshfeld surface analysis was performed, which showed the dominant role of H center dot center dot center dot H contacts (51.3%).
